A case of successful endoscopic treatment of a patient with acute post-manipulation pancreatitis due to anomaly of the pancreas

S.Yu. Orlov, A.N. Alimov, T.P. Chelyapina, E.E. Kudryavitskii

We report a case of acute pancreatitis after endoscopic removal of the minor duodenal papilla in a woman with a congenital malformation of the pancreatic ductal system. This case demonstrates the role of the minor papilla in the pancreatic function and the ability of pancreatic stenting in the treatment of acute pancreatitis caused by papillary injury.
